Behavioural Mechanics
Understanding why this substitution might occur requires separating the two categories analytically, even though the signal treats them as one.
For audio, the previous default was a wired connection between a playback device and headphones — a low-cost, dependable, but physically constraining setup. The emerging behaviour, wireless earbuds, removes the physical tether at the cost of introducing battery management, charging cases, and a different price point. The plausible behavioural driver is a preference for physical freedom and portability, enabled by the technical maturation of Bluetooth-class wireless audio chipsets to a point where latency and battery life are no longer prohibitive for mainstream use.
For video, the previous default was a set-top box supplied by a pay-TV provider, typically bundled with a subscription contract and tied to a specific delivery infrastructure (cable, satellite, or fibre). The emerging behaviour, streaming devices, decouples the hardware from the content provider: a single device can access multiple content sources through installed applications rather than a single provider's channel lineup. The plausible driver here is less about physical convenience and more about content flexibility and potentially lower or more controllable ongoing costs, alongside the broader move of content owners toward direct-to-consumer distribution models.
What unites the two, if the pairing is meaningful, is a shift in where control sits: from the hardware/service provider to the end consumer, and from a wired, fixed infrastructure to a wireless or networked one. This is a coherent behavioural narrative, but it remains an inference drawn from the signal's framing rather than a finding demonstrated by the evidence provided.
